Polybar enable-keyboard

A simple polybar-enableKeyboard module that adds an icon that changes dinamically accordingly to thte keyboard status

on When the keyboard is on

off When the keyboard is off

Dependencies

  • xinput
  • Font Awesome 6 Free

Installation

Need to change script:

in keyboardenable.sh

#!/bin/env bash
# find this id 
id=$(xinput | grep "Asus Keyboard .* (3)]" | grep -Po 'id=\K\d+')
# find device status
device_enable=$(xinput list-props $id | grep 'Device Enabled' | grep -Eo '(0|1)$')

if [ $device_enable -eq 1 ]; then
  xinput disable $id
else
  xinput enable $id
fi

in keyboard.sh

#!/bin/env bash
 id=$(xinput | grep "Asus Keyboard .* (3)]" | grep -Po 'id=\K\d+')
 device_enable=$(xinput list-props $id | grep 'Device Enabled' | grep -Eo '(0|1)$')
 if [ $device_enable -eq 1 ]; then
   echo "%{F#42A5F5}"
 else
   echo "%{F#2e317c}"
 fi

Asus Keyboard is my computer keyboard

If you want to know your computer keyboard, you can do:

> xinput
⎡ Virtual core pointer                    	id=2	[master pointer  (3)]
⎜   ↳ Virtual core XTEST pointer              	id=4	[slave  pointer  (2)]
⎜   ↳ ASUE120A:00 04F3:319B Mouse             	id=11	[slave  pointer  (2)]
⎜   ↳ ASUE120A:00 04F3:319B Touchpad          	id=12	[slave  pointer  (2)]
⎜   ↳ Asus Keyboard                           	id=14	[slave  pointer  (2)]
⎜   ↳ Logitech G304                           	id=16	[slave  pointer  (2)]
⎣ Virtual core keyboard                   	id=3	[master keyboard (2)]
    ↳ Virtual core XTEST keyboard             	id=5	[slave  keyboard (3)]
    ↳ Asus Wireless Radio Control             	id=6	[slave  keyboard (3)]
    ↳ Video Bus                               	id=7	[slave  keyboard (3)]
    ↳ Power Button                            	id=8	[slave  keyboard (3)]
    ↳ Sleep Button                            	id=9	[slave  keyboard (3)]
    ↳ Topre Corporation HHKB Professional     	id=10	[slave  keyboard (3)]
    ↳ Asus WMI hotkeys                        	id=13	[slave  keyboard (3)]
    ↳ Asus Keyboard                           	id=15	[slave  keyboard (3)]
    ↳ Logitech G304   

we can find Asus Keyboard in Virtual core keyboard

we replaced Asus Keyboard for your Device

Place the shell script files in your preferred sctipt directory.

Add the module to your polybar config file

[module/keyboardenable]
type = custom/script
exec = path/to/scripts/keyboard.sh
interval = 2
click-left = exec path/to/scripts/keyboardenable.sh
click-right = exec path/to/scripts/keyboardenable.sh
